Toto Wolff urges Liberty not to 'mess' with F1 approach

Mercedes boss Toto Wolff believes Liberty media must not “mess” with Formula 1, and urges any potential changes to be carefully analysed before being implemented. Liberty Media announced on Monday that it had acquired Formula 1, installing Chase Carey as CEO, with Ross Brawn and Sean Bratches appointed managing directors of the sporting and commercial side respectively.
